When contemplating the installation of glass fencing, it's essential to familiarize yourself with native building codes for glass fencing. These regulations make positive that safety, aesthetic, and structural standards are met. Various municipalities have specific codes that dictate how glass fencing could be installed, maintained, and modified. Understanding these codes is essential for compliance and safety.


The use of glass fencing in residential and industrial properties has gained recognition due to its modern aesthetic and unobstructed views. However, with this increased demand comes the need for adherence to native constructing codes for glass fencing. These codes usually define specifications concerning the sort of glass to be used, the peak of the fencing, and the means it ought to be secured.

Local building codes for glass fencing differ considerably from one region to a different. In some areas, tempered glass is required because of its elevated durability and safety options. This kind of glass is much less more likely to shatter, minimizing the danger of injury. Knowing what's mandated in your area can save time and sources when planning your project.


Beyond the kind of glass, local building codes typically establish minimum height necessities for fencing. This regulation primarily aims to make sure safety, particularly in residential areas where youngsters and pets could additionally be present. Compliance with these height requirements is non-negotiable, as failing to meet the specifications could result in penalties or the necessity to take down the installation.

Additionally, glass fencing must usually adhere to specific wind load standards. High-wind areas could require thicker glass panels or further assist structures to resist sturdy winds. Local building codes generally provide guidelines on the mandatory engineering practices required to make sure the fence remains securely in place beneath varied climatic conditions.


Another essential facet is the sort of framing or help used for the glass panels. Local codes usually mandate that the framing materials be both corrosion-resistant or in any other case suitable for the particular environmental circumstances. This helps guarantee the long-term durability of the fencing whereas sustaining its aesthetic appeal.

  • Local constructing codes for glass fencing often specify the minimal height for safety and privacy, usually ranging from 1.2 to 1.eight meters.

  • Regulations could require the use of tempered or laminated glass to reinforce energy and reduce the danger of breakage.

  • Codes normally dictate the type of framing supplies acceptable for glass fencing, which should provide sufficient assist and durability.

  • Compliance with local zoning legal guidelines could impact the place glass fencing may be put in, particularly relating to property strains and setbacks.

  • Many jurisdictions implement tips on the spacing of fence posts to make sure structural integrity and forestall sagging.

  • Some areas mandate that glass fencing must be non-climbable, necessitating specific design features to discourage unauthorized access.

  • Local fireplace safety regulations may influence glass fencing installations, especially in high-risk areas susceptible to wildfires.

  • Maintenance necessities, corresponding to cleaning and inspections, are sometimes outlined in constructing codes to make sure long-lasting safety and look.

  • Some codes may require specific signage indicating the presence of glass fencing to alert guests about potential hazards.
